Nitrous Oxide

Nitrous oxide is a safe and effective sedative, and it’s been used in dentistry for more than one hundred years. You probably know of it as “laughing gas.” Nitrous oxide may or may not make you laugh, but it will put you in a relaxed state for your procedure.

It does not make you sleep. When you are under the influence of nitrous oxide, you’ll be aware of your surroundings at all times. You’ll hear any questions that we may put to you, and answer them coherently.

To administer nitrous oxide, you wear a mask that covers your nose. It works quickly, and most patients report feeling light-headed, and sometimes with a tingling sensation in the arms and legs. Others say their limbs feel heavy. What almost everyone says is that they’re calm and comfortable. When the procedure is finished, the effects of laughing gas wear off quickly.
